Yes, she had a UTI and her incision was infected as well. I had no idea because it wasn't red, swollen or oozing anything at all, I checked it daily. When doc took the first stitch out, it her flesh didn't stay closed and some puss oozed out. Normally our vet uses the stitches inside that disolve on their own and then uses surgical glue on the outside, but I had requested that he use stitched and surgical glue on the outside of Jazzie, simply because when Mags and Gracie were spayed, they both popped open, and when Gracie popped open, it was on a weekend and I had to wait until the next day to get her in. I cleaned the area as good as I could and put butterfly stitches on it like crazy until the vet was open the next day, he said it looked pretty good and was able to use stitches and close her back up and put her on an antibiotic just in case since she popped open. He used surgical glue to re-close Mags. I'm just glad all the female furkids are now spayed and I'm hoping for a good report for Jazzie on Saturday.
